Quote:
Originally Posted by Animal78 View Post
I am curious to know what its like at cruising speeds. No loud drone? I really just want to have a tip that sticks out the back some. Simply for looks. I had a 04 Dodge Neon SRT-4 and it was waaayyy too loud out on the highway especially!
There is no loud drone, whatsoever. Cruising speeds are very mellow. is it louder, but in a good way. It's real deep and mellow. Don't sound "ricey" at all. In the cab with the windows up, you can't hardly hear it at all.
